Welcome aboard! This PR bumps the Quillbus broker from 3.x to 5.x for the Fernlake cluster. Biggest changes: the new ack model means consumers must commit offsets explicitly, and the old retry queue config is gone. I migrated all the topic definitions and smoke-tested against staging. Please double-check the consumer timeouts — 5.x defaults are way more aggressive. The tuning values we're shipping with are below.

tuning constants:
QUOTAS = {
    "druwyn": 5,
    "holix": 5,
    "zorath": 5,
    "holwyn": 10,
}

Changed defaults in Splitfork, our assignment service. Bucketing now uses sticky hashing per account instead of per session, and the holdout slice grew from 2% to 5%. Callers relying on session-level reassignment must opt in explicitly. Review the diff against the new baseline; the updated default configuration is listed below.

config for tagep-kajof:
[casir]
port = 6379
region = south-1
host = casir.paliqdyn.example
team = tamax
timeout_ms = 250
retries = 2

UserSplit Cutover Drift: the extracted account service and the legacy Marigold monolith user module are reporting divergent record counts during dual-write. This fires when drift exceeds 0.5% over 15 minutes. New team members should not replay writes manually. Reconciliation steps and the rollback procedure are documented on the internal page.

wiki page, tajog-fafog: https://gitlab.paliqsys.corp/dash/display/job/853dd6fcbf54

Welcome to the Wanderhall team! Wanderhall powers the self-guided audio tours at the fictional Brindlemore Museum of Curiosities. Before running the app locally, clone the repo and install dependencies with the standard bootstrap script. The backend fetches narration clips from our media service, which requires authentication on every request. Create a file named .env in the project root and open it in your editor. On the first line, add the following entry exactly as shown:

env line for fafof-fahag: LEDGER_TOKEN5=f8790